Removing tint on your windows has never been this easy. All you need to do is have a newspaper, a cleaning sponge and a pale of soap and water. Here are some easy steps on how to remove window tint using newspaper and soap only. Start by making a mixture of soap and water which you will be using. Next, use your household cleaning sponge to apply it to your window. Make sure that all the surface area of the window will be covered with soap and water.
Once all areas of the window have been soaked with soap and water, you can now then apply the newspaper on your window. Make sure it fits right in your window and all the tinted areas of the window are directly touching the newspaper you placed. It doesn’t matter if the newspaper is old or new as long as it is a newspaper that you can use. Leave the newspaper in place for approximately one hour. If you see the newspaper sliding off your window, reapply the soap and water mixture to the newspaper to make it stick even more to the tinted window. You can do this every 10-15 minutes to ensure that the newspaper is making contact with the tint films.
